MATTER OF HOLLAND v. NEW YORK CITY HEALTH & HOSPS. CORP.


81 A.D.2d 638 (1981)

In the Matter of Geraldine Holland, Petitioner, and Robert Holland, Appellant, v. New York City Health and Hospitals Corporation et al., Respondents

Appellate Division of the Supreme Court of the State of New York, Second Department.

April 20, 1981


Order affirmed insofar as appealed from, without costs or disbursements.

It was a proper exercise of discretion under the circumstances to grant leave to the injured petitioner to file a late notice of claim.
